The property consists of 11.789 acres of grass land bisected by the Lyndon Brook, a 3.58 acre area of ancient broadleaved woodland incorporating a duck pond, and is bounded by the River Chater on the south. The land is fenced with two gated access points from both Glebe Road and Lyndon Road. The grass land is defined as Grade 3 by the Agricultural Land Classification of England and Wales and is classified as the Denchworth series, with fine loamy over clayey soils. The property adjoins the south-west edge of the village and includes a scheduled monument, North Luffenham Moated Site, at the southern end of the grass land, situated in a Rectangular-shaped area with prominent external banks and a former fishpond.
